King Charles III speaks for the first time. Hear what he had to say

September 9, 2022

In his first address to the United Kingdom, the Commonwealth and the world, the new King Charles III mirrored his late mother’s famous speech about the responsibility, duty and service required of the monarch

King Charles talked about the continuity and the steadiness his mother, Queen Elizabeth brought to the crown and said he plans to continue down that same path. Also expressed his grief over the loss of his mother, he paid tribute to the life she lived, said thanks to everyone who has sent condolences to the royal family – and briefly laid out what’s next for his immediate family.

He talked about his “darling” Camilla, praising her for her years of service to the people since they married 17 years ago calling her his Queen consort, he said William and Catherine will now become the Prince and Princess of Wales and William will also inherit the Scottish titles that were once held by the King and will also become the Duke of Cornwall. The King even mentioned his love for Harry and Megan “as they continue to build their life overseas”

After talking about all that has changed in the world and to the monarchy since Queen Elizabeth ascended the throne more than 70 years ago, he ended the 9 minute speech by acknowledging both of his parents.
